Financial Accountant

Finance | Melbourne, Australia | Full Time

Job Description

An exciting opportunity to join our Finance team!

The Financial Accountant for the Australasia region plays a pivotal role in ensuring the timely and accurate closure of monthly accounts, thereby upholding the integrity and precision of the company's financial records.

Assisting the Regional Finance Manager, the role will be responsible for preparation of annual financial statements, handling of GST filings, and efficient coordination for annual tax submissions, delivering ad hoc reports and providing essential management reporting.

Playing a crucial part in the strategic planning process, actively assisting budgeting and forecasting to shape the company's financial future in the region this is a Permanent Full Time Opportunity tailored to the unique financial and regulatory landscape of the Australasia region.

Responsibilities include:

Month End Closing

  • Preparing accruals for annual incentive and sales incentives
  • Checking coding and updating accruals for unsubmitted credit card expenses, and validating other accounts payable accruals
  • Analysing and validating credit notes with Office Managers
  • Balance sheet and intercompany reconciliations and settlement
  • Ensure timely and accurate recording of financial transactions.
  • Reconcile discrepancies and ensure that financial records align with internal controls and regional standards.
  • Collaborate with other finance and operational teams to close the books efficiently and with the highest degree of accuracy.

GST Filing, Tax and Financial statements

  • Assisting external consultants with their preparation of annual financial statements and tax filings for NZ and Japan.
  • Preparing working paper for GST filings in NZ and PNG

Budgeting/Forecasting

  • Support the financial planning process by assisting in the preparation of budgets and forecasts for the Australasia region.
  • Analyse past financial data to provide insights into future financial planning.
  • Work closely with department heads and management to understand operational needs and how they translate into financial projections.

Other Responsibilities

  • Support ad-hoc projects with financial modelling / recommendations
  • Creating and updating internal management KPI reports
  • Conducting internal audits to identify risks and recommend mitigation strategies.
  • Developing / maintaining new reports to support the ongoing growth of the region.
  • Advising the wider team with invoice and expense coding queries, promoting best practice
  • Work closely with other corporate finance teams including Group Financial Accounts, Accounts Payable, Accounts Receivable, Tax and Financial planning & analysis.
